What is What Is an Adjustable Rate Mortgage?

An adjustable-rate mortgage (ARM) starts with a fixed introductory rate for 3, 5, 7 or 10 years, then adjusts periodically based on an index plus margin. ARMs often carry lower initial rates but expose borrowers to future payment shock.
